#ed68c7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ed68c7 is composed of 92.9% red, 40.8%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 16%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 317.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 66.9%. #ed68c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ff with #db008f.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#ed68c7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070105 is the darkest color, while #fef4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ed68c7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ca9ab is the less saturated color, while #fa5bcd is the most saturated one.
